Leadership Overview

Delta Community Supports has 5 executives leading key functions including strategy, operations, organizational alignment, financial management, and human resources.

Committed to empowering individuals with developmental disabilities, Delta Community Supports delivers data-informed services across Pennsylvania and New Jersey to foster independence and community integration.

Leadership Roles at Delta Community Supports

  • Chief Executive Officer - Gus Gale
  • Chief Financial Officer - Jill Bennett
  • Chief Operating Officer - Catherine McLain
  • Chief of Staff - Sarah Baker-Ambrose
  • Chief Human Resources Officer - Andrew Ward
